メインコンテンツまでスキップ

CombositeKazokuDataService

家族データを取得するサービス

警告

※ 既にインスタンス化されているものが提供されるのでcombositeDataService.kazokuDataを使用してアクセスしてください。

詳しくは例を参照してください。

Extends

  • CombositeKazokuDataProviderServiceBase<CombositeDataOperator>

Methods

readByEmployeeId()

readByEmployeeId(employeeIdList): Promise<KazokuDataEntity[]>

従業員IDから従業員本人の家族データを取得する

Parameters

ParameterTypeDescription
employeeIdListstring[]従業員ID

Returns

Promise<KazokuDataEntity[]>

KazokuDataEntity[] 家族データの配列

Example

利用例

  const employeeIdList = ['FM001275', 'FM001276']
const response = await combositeDataService.kazokuData.readByEmployeeId(employeeIdList)

Inherited from

CombositeKazokuDataProviderServiceBase.readByEmployeeId

readByEmployeeIdAndBaseDate()

readByEmployeeIdAndBaseDate(employeeIdList, baseDate): Promise<KazokuDataEntity[]>

従業員IDと日付から従業員本人の家族データを取得する

Parameters

ParameterTypeDescription
employeeIdListstring[]従業員ID
baseDatestring日付 (yyyy/MM/dd)

Returns

Promise<KazokuDataEntity[]>

KazokuDataEntity[] 家族データの配列

Example

利用例

  const shainId = 'FM001275'
const baseDate = '2025/01/01'
const response = await combositeDataService.kazokuData.readByEmployeeIdAndBaseDate(shainId, baseDate)

Inherited from

CombositeKazokuDataProviderServiceBase.readByEmployeeIdAndBaseDate